Linguistic extension of L2T-VIKOR
L2T-VIKOR (Linguistic extension of L2T-VIKOR) is a ranking multi-criteria decision-making (MCDM) method introduced by Ju, Y., Wang, A. in 2013. It turns a decision matrix of alternatives scored on multiple criteria into a structured, reproducible result.

When to use it
l2t-vikor extends L2T-VIKOR to handle Linguistic uncertainty. All arithmetic operations (normalisation, weighting, distance computation) are performed using 2-Tuple Linguistic Variable (2TL: (s_i, α)) algebra. The final scores are defuzzified via Δ^{-1}(s_i, α) = i + α before ranking.
